Understanding the Different Types of Garden Weeders

Before selecting a weeder, it is useful to understand the various types available. Each type is designed for specific gardening needs and weed characteristics.

Hand weeders are compact tools ideal for small gardens, raised beds, and tight spaces. They work well for removing shallow-rooted weeds and for tasks requiring precise control. Long-handled weeders, on the other hand, reduce bending and kneeling by allowing you to work while standing. These are perfect for larger areas or when you need to remove tall or deep-rooted weeds.

Some weeders come with forks or claw-like tips that grip weed roots firmly, while others use a flat or serrated blade to slice weeds at the soil line. The best choice depends on your garden’s layout and the types of weeds you commonly encounter.

Key Features to Look For in a Garden Weeder

When selecting a garden weeder, several important features should guide your decision. Durability is essential because the tool must withstand regular use and varying soil conditions. Look for weeders made from strong metals such as stainless steel or high-carbon steel, as these materials resist bending and rust.

Comfort is another key factor. A well-designed handle reduces hand fatigue and improves grip, especially during long weeding sessions. Ergonomic handles made with non-slip materials provide better control and prevent strain.

Weight and balance also matter. A lightweight weeder is easier to maneuver, while a balanced design ensures smoother, more accurate movement. For long-handled weeders, check that the length suits your height so you can work comfortably without unnecessary bending.

Matching the Weeder to Your Garden’s Needs

Every garden is different, so the best weeder for your space depends on your soil type, plant layout, and weed growth patterns. In loose or sandy soil, a forked weeder easily lifts out weeds with minimal disturbance. In dense or clay-heavy soil, a stronger tool with a sharp blade may be more effective at cutting through compacted areas.

If your garden contains closely spaced plants, choose a narrow, precise weeder to avoid damaging roots or stems. For open areas or lawns, long-handled weeders allow you to cover more ground efficiently. Understanding your environment ensures that the tool you choose will provide the best results.

Tips for Long-Term Tool Maintenance

To keep your garden weeder in excellent condition, clean it after every use. Remove soil, rinse with water, and dry it thoroughly to prevent corrosion. Sharpen the blade or tip occasionally to maintain its effectiveness.

Storing the tool in a dry place also extends its lifespan. Applying a light coat of oil to metal parts helps prevent rust, ensuring your weeder remains dependable season after season.
